Understanding Cavitation

Cavitation occurs when the pressure of a liquid drops below its vapor pressure, causing the formation of vapor bubbles. These bubbles then collapse when they enter a region of higher pressure. The collapse of these bubbles generates high - energy shock waves that can cause damage to the valve components, such as erosion, pitting, and noise. In severe cases, cavitation can lead to the failure of the valve, resulting in leakage and reduced system efficiency.

Factors Affecting Cavitation Resistance in Soft - Seal Ball Valves

  1. Material of the Seal: Soft - seal ball valves typically use materials such as rubber, P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ene), or other elastomers for the seal. The choice of material plays a vital role in cavitation resistance. For example, PTFE has excellent chemical resistance and low friction, which can help reduce the risk of cavitation - induced damage. It can withstand a certain level of pressure fluctuations without being easily eroded by the collapsing vapor bubbles.
  2. Valve Design: The design of the soft - seal ball valve also affects its cavitation resistance. A well - designed valve will have a smooth flow path to minimize pressure drops and turbulence. For instance, the shape of the ball and the seat can influence the flow pattern. A valve with a full - bore design allows for a more uniform flow, reducing the likelihood of cavitation. Additionally, the valve's internal geometry can be optimized to control the pressure distribution, preventing the formation of low - pressure regions where cavitation is likely to occur.
  3. Operating Conditions: The operating conditions, including the fluid properties, pressure, and flow rate, have a direct impact on cavitation. High - velocity flows and large pressure differentials across the valve are more likely to cause cavitation. For example, in a system where the fluid has a low vapor pressure and is flowing at a high speed, the risk of cavitation is increased. Soft - seal ball valves need to be selected and sized appropriately based on the specific operating conditions to ensure adequate cavitation resistance.

How Soft - Seal Ball Valves Resist Cavitation

  1. Sealing Mechanism: The soft - seal in ball valves provides a tight seal, which helps to prevent fluid leakage and reduce the chances of pressure fluctuations that can lead to cavitation. The elastic nature of the soft - seal material allows it to conform to the surface of the ball, creating a reliable barrier against fluid flow. This helps maintain a stable pressure within the valve and reduces the risk of cavitation.
  2. Energy Dissipation: Some soft - seal ball valves are designed with features that help dissipate the energy generated by the collapsing vapor bubbles. For example, certain valve designs may incorporate damping elements or flow - control devices that can absorb the shock waves produced during cavitation, reducing the damage to the valve components.

Applications and the Importance of Cavitation Resistance

Soft - seal ball valves are widely used in various industries, such as water treatment, chemical processing, and food and beverage. In water treatment plants, these valves are used to control the flow of water and chemicals. Cavitation can cause damage to the valves, leading to leakage and reduced water quality. Therefore, high cavitation resistance is essential to ensure the reliable operation of the water treatment system.

In the chemical processing industry, soft - seal ball valves are used to handle corrosive and high - pressure fluids. Cavitation can accelerate the corrosion process and damage the valve seals, resulting in potential safety hazards. A valve with good cavitation resistance can withstand the harsh operating conditions and ensure the safe and efficient operation of the chemical processing system.
